I've been trying to find out some answers with previous threads but nothing exactly matched what I have so I am writing this for help.

I have Xbox Ver 1.5 with X3. It's been working fine since the X3 release date, but today I tried upgrading my HD and bios and I am having a major problem with my box. First let me say that I've done the following to make sure that I am not doing something stupid,

1) All my solder points are sound. I've checked twice to make sure that I don't have any bad points.
2) 2 blue LEDs on the chip lit up.
3) Made sure that flash protection is off
4) External switch is removed for flashing.
5) When X3 removed Xbox boots fine.

The problem is that when I power up, I get 2 short bootup/off then FRAG.
I can go into FLASHBIOS 3.0.0, but none of the flash method works. The network update says "unknown flash! Halting". Yes, I've read that this could be related to the flash protection, but I don't see how this could be a problem when I can't flash either with or without protection on many times.
